Channel 351 – Actuator Alarms (Index 111)

This channel, DI_ACTUATOR_ALARMS_CHAN, makes actuator alarms available to other function
blocks. The alarms include:

• Local emergency shutdown has occurred; the field unit will command the actuator to go to a pre-

configured position, or stop, or ignore the ESD.

• Remote emergency shutdown has been received from the network host; the field unit will

command the actuator to go to a pre-configured position, or stop, or ignore the ESD.

• Open inhibit is active.
• Close inhibit is active.

Channel 351

DI_ACTUATOR_ALARMS_CHAN

Value

Local ESD Active

0x01

Remote ESD Active

0x02

Open Inhibit Active

0x04

Close Inhibit Active

0x08

Local ESD Active + Open Inhibit Active

0x05

Local ESD Active + Close Inhibit Active

0x09

Remote ESD Active + Open Inhibit Active

0x06

Remote ESD Active + Close Inhibit Active

0x0A

Open Inhibit Active + Close Inhibit Active

0x0C

Channel 352 – Discrete User Input (Index 112)

This channel, DI_DISC_USER_INPUT_CHAN, makes general-purpose contact inputs available to other
function blocks. The functions in the table, such as ESD, must be configured to the OFF state locally
in the MX/QX PB setup menus in order to use the inputs as general-purpose inputs. Functions, such
as ESD, when configured to OFF, are not enabled. Refer to the following sections in MX Installation &
Operation Manual, LMENIM2306, and QX Installation & Operation Manual, LMENIM3306:

• Section 4.15 – ESD – Emergency Shutdown
• Section 4.16 – Inhibits – Open/Close Inhibit
• Section 4.13 – Remote Control – Open/Close/Stop Pushbutton Inputs
This channel places each discrete input bit value to 0 if the discrete input is not enabled.

Channel 352

DI_DISC_USER_INPUT_CHAN

Terminal #

Alt

Function

Value

User Input Number 0

30

ESD Open

Bit 0

User Input Number 1

34

Open Inhibit

Bit 1

User Input Number 2

35

Close Inhibit

Bit 2

User Input Number 3

26

Stop PBS Input

Bit 3

User Input Number 4

25

Open PBS Input

Bit 4

User Input Number 5

27

Close PBS Input Bit 5
